I am new to the Audio Karma forum and I was encouraged by a fellow member to post a few pictures of my newly restored 1965 Fisher Ambassador Console.
I purchased the console this past winter and with the help of "Larry" an expert on Fisher 59A/59T amps and tuners, I was able to totally recap and restore the Danish Modern console to perfect working condition.
Notice the added "equalizer" that I installed in the compartment that the reel to reel would have been housed. I used the "reverb" hook ups in the preamp to intragrate the equalizer. It really smoothed out the highs and mid range tones that I was not fond of.
